Athens Man Arrested for Armed Robbery Involving Gunfire

Marvin Fletcher was arrested in Athens on August 30, 2026, in connection with a robbery that involved the discharge of a firearm. The incident began when two victims were approached by a man demanding their wallets, leading to a rapidly escalating confrontation.

During the encounter, one of the victims, who was armed, fired in self-defense. This action resulted in gunfire, significantly altering the course of the incident. Following the shooting, Fletcher was found nearby with a gunshot wound and was transported for medical treatment to address his injuries.

Authorities have since charged Fletcher with first-degree robbery. He is currently incarcerated and awaits court proceedings related to the incident. The legal process will determine the next steps in this case.
